In addition to lining the pockets of miners, mining serves a second and critical purpose: it's the only means to discharge new cryptocurrency into circulation. In other words, miners are basically"minting" currency. For example, as of the time of writing this piece, there were about 17 million Bitcoin in circulation.

In the absence of miners, Bitcoin would nevertheless exist and be usable, but there might never be any additional Bitcoin. There will come a time when Bitcoin mining ends; per the Bitcoin Protocol, the number of Bitcoin will likely be capped at 21 million. Bitcoin are mined in units called"cubes" At this time of writing, the reward for completing a cube is 12.5 Bitcoin. At today's cost of about $10,000 each Bitcoin, this means you'd earn (12.5 x 10,000)$125,000.

When Bitcoin was first mined in 2009, mining one block would earn you 50 BTC. In 2012, this was halved to 25 BTC. In 2016, this was halved to the current degree of 12.5 BTC. In 2020 or so, the reward size will be halved again to 6.25 BTC.

Miners are getting paid for their work as auditors. They're doing the job of verifying previous Bitcoin transactions. This convention is meant to maintain Bitcoin users honest, and was conceived by Bitcoin's founder, Satoshi Nakamoto. By verifying transactions, miners are helping to prevent the"double-spending problem."
